Transaction 64f7eabc8f6d84fc88780a974fd3425cbc4f165047bf865ca42560bb30e20afc
1 Input
2 Outputs
- 64f7eabc8f6d84fc88780a974fd3425cbc4f165047bf865ca42560bb30e20afc:0
- 64f7eabc8f6d84fc88780a974fd3425cbc4f165047bf865ca42560bb30e20afc:1
value 508760000
address 15Sqf82Vgmfa2q6Fqycc6QQr9wZasKph4S
value 100000000
address 18UKTxxejzrT2gbgzopZV8EasQPJFrTNXK